Mirror-Drawing Task
A neuropsychological test that assesses motor coordination and learning by having an individual trace a drawing seen only in a mirror.
Motor Memory
The form of memory related to the preservation of motor skills, allowing for the performance of tasks without conscious effort upon repetition.
Sensory Perception
The process of receiving and interpreting sensory information through the five senses: sight, hearing, touch, taste, and smell.
Brainbow
A technique in neuroscience that uses genetic methods to label individual neurons with a multitude of fluorescent proteins, allowing for the visualization of neural circuits in multiple colors.
